What's In My Travel Make Up Bag

Today then I bring you what I am taking in way of make-up on holiday (skincare item post tomorrow.)

There is not actually a lot at all. I am fully expecting to not put much on, if any some days & thus refuse to take too much with me.


The bag is a Clinique one that I got with a Bonus Time gift. Its just the right size & wipe clean. Perfect!

For under my make-up then ( as I felt the SPF face cream part of my make up routine.)
Clinique Face Cream with SPF 30. I will probably use this every day regardless of whether I actually put make up on as I have to cover up as best as I can. I may use this in place of a moisturiser during my morning skincare routine.
Then my face primer will be my beloved Nars Light Optimizing Primer. I was not going to take this one as there is a not a great deal left. But actually as I may not use as much anyway plus its the smallest of the primers I have so made more sense that way. Its also the best one & will hold make up in place longer than the others.

Base & Cheeks now. I am not taking a Foundation cream. I will just conceal with Collection Lasting Perfection Concealer ( in Warm Beige - 3,) Estee Lauder Double Wear Stay In Place make up ( mine is a sample in Fresco - 02.) Then on my cheeks I will use only Maybelline Dream Sun Bronzing Powder With Blush.

Eyes & Eye Brows. I am only using my Seventeen Clear Definitions Mascara. I really am not bothered about filling them in whilst on holiday!
Eye shadow primer is Bare Minerals Prime Time Eyelid Primer & eye shadow  will be my NYX Ombre Trio, whilst mascara will be Estee Lauder Sumptuous Extreme in Extreme Black.

Just one lipstick. Maybelline Lip Colour in Absolute Plum.

Lastly the brushes I will take.
Real Technique Brushes - Expert Face Brush, Setting Brush & Shading Brush.
Superdrug Eyeshadow Liner Brush.
